The State Government with the approval of the Latrobe Council is demolishing the Bell's Parade Railway Bridge without asking the community for their input. They both have had alternatives put forward to them without any fair or just investigation into the opportunities the bridge may offer to the economic and employment growth within the Latrobe Municipality and the region as a whole.

The Railway Bridge which is 125 years old is an integral part of the Latrobe Township's culture. The bridge has significant heritage values to the whole region as it was the connection for Launceston to the North West Coast, thus being the integral link to the growth of the region to where it is today.

We the undersigned, call on the State Government and the Premier to instantly put a stay in proceeding with the demolition of the Bell's Parade Railway Bridge.

To call with the Latrobe Council a public forum at Latrobe involving all stakeholders, that offers the community an opportunity to have their say in the future of the Railway Bridge.

To seriously investigate any alternatives that may be put forward that enhance the economic and employment opportunities within the Latrobe Municipality.
